Fondazione Memmo inaugurates the first institutional exhibition in Italy by Portia Zvavahera, curated by Alessio Antoniolli, scheduled from Wednesday, April 29 to Sunday, November 1, 2026.


For the occasion, Zvavahera presents a site-specific installation specially conceived for the spaces of the Foundation and a new body of paintings, developed following a residency period in Rome. The project represents a significant phase of the artist's recent research, where the autobiographical dimension intertwines with a broader reflection on memory, loss, and transcendence.

In her works, Zvavahera gives shape to emotions that emerge from realms and dimensions beyond the domains of daily life and thought. Her images, vibrant and visionary, delve into the cornerstones of earthly existence - life and death, love and loss - translating intimate experiences into layered pictorial scenarios. These visions take form through surfaces built up through accumulation: the artist combines expressive brushstrokes, intense color passages, and complex printing techniques to generate dense and pulsating visual fields.


For her first solo exhibition in Rome, the artist focuses her investigation on a particularly intimate and meditative thematic core linked to the passing of her grandmother: an experience that continues to resurface in dreamlike forms, along with the idea of paradise and how her imagination guides earthly life, intertwining with the joys and anxieties of daily life. In this perspective, the dream, with its symbolic and emotional layers, remains a fundamental generative matrix.

On a technical level, this vision translates into a free and experimental practice that integrates drawing, gestural painting, and woodcut printing. Through a vibrant chromatic layering, Zvavahera superimposes complex patterns and figures in a calibrated play of transparencies and opacities, using hand-cut stencils and repeated motifs to generate a rhythmic tension that gives the painted surfaces depth, density, and movement.
